Hey guys. I was talking to someone that was concerned about a site like facebook (or any other site) accessing the data they share on another site when the browser is open.

Theres a few things you can do with firefox. Disable WebRTC for one and a feature called Containers


Now heres an example of how it works. Each site you want to separate from the others you open a container and set it there.

Now in settings you can block all cookies and then make an exception for certain websites.

You can additionally keep opening in private windows but its much easier to just keep all your common websites and google especially to its own container.
